  • Frances S.
  • Ligler (born June 11, 1951) is a biochemist and bioengineer who was a 2017 inductee of the National Inventors Hall of Fame.
  • Ligler's research dramatically improved the effectiveness of biosensors while at the same time reducing their size and increasing automation.
  • Her work on biosensors made it easier to detect toxins and pathogens in food, water, or when airborne.
  • In a 2017 interview, Ligler summarized her work: "Optical biosensors is a whole field where biological molecules are being used for recognition and transduce an optical signal to a small device.
  • My teams and I demonstrated the use of optical biosensors for detection of pathogens in food, infectious diseases in people, biological warfare agents, environmental pollutants, explosives and drugs of abuse — things that can kill you." Ligler's interests include microfluidics, tissue on chips, optical analytical devices, biosensors and nanotechnology.
  • Ligler holds 32 patents and has authored over 400 scientific papers.
